نمونه کد های excel vba-تبدیل اعداد به کلمه در اکسل

شاید برای شما دوستان پیش بیاید که اعداد را در اکسل به حروف و کلمه تبدیل کنید.به عنوان مثال شخصی را در نظر بگیرید که باید از طریق تلفن کد قطعات ماشین آلات را به زبان انگلیسی به شخص دیگر بیان کند یا اینکه کد قعات را به صورت حروف آماده کند(این مثال کاملا واقعی بوده و اتفاق افتاده است)

اما یکی دیگر از کاربرد های این کار کمک به زبان آموزان انگلیسی می باشد.یکی از مباحث آموزشی در زبان انگلیسی توانایی بیان اعداد می باشد.خیلی از زبان آموزان برای اینکه خود را محک بزنند باید عددی را در ذهن تصور کنند و بعد آن را بیان کنید.برای درست بودن بیان خود این تابع کمک زیادی به شما خواهد کرد.اما اکسل تابعی برای این کار ندارد و باید به روش های دیگر به این خواسته برسیم.

توجه کنید که در این فرمول برای بیان از and استفاده نمی شود(چون در بسیاری منابع گفته شده است که در بیان به لهجه آمریکن از and استفاده نمی شود ولی در بریتیش از آن استفاده می کنند)

برای استفاده از این کد ،نرم افزار اکسل را اجرا کنید.وارد محیط ویرایشگر vba شوید.(Alt+F11)مانند تصویر زیر بر روی Module کلیک کنید.

تابع تبدیل اعداد به حروف به انگلیسی

اکنون کد های زیر را مانند تصویر زیر در Module1 کپی کنید.

کد نویسی برای تبدیل اعداد به حروف در اکسل

توجه کنید که فایل را حتما به صورت Excel macro-enabled workbook ذخیره کنید.

تابع تبدیل اعداد به حروف در اکسل SpellNumber

برای دیدن ادامه مطلب اگر عضو هستید وارد شوید، اگر عضو نیستید عضو سایت شوید یا اشتراک خود را ارتقاء دهید.
ورودثبت نام

 

دیدگاه ها

  1. HASHMATULLAH گفت:

    خوب میشد که آن کد را به صورت داکمنت می گذاشید که میتوانیستم کاپی کنیم

    • آموزش آفیس گفت:

      با سلام
      دوست عزیز قابل کپی شدن هست.کافیست دوبار روی کد کلیک کنید،تا کل کدها انتخاب (select) بشه بعد اون رو به راحتی کپی کنید.
      موفق باشید.

  2. سینا گفت:

    سلام
    ممنون میشم اگه راهی برای فارسی کردن این ماژول وجود داره ، اعلام کنید

    متشکرم

  3. فروغ گفت:

    بسیار عالی و کارآمد بود خیلی ازتون ممنونم فقط راهی نیست که به فارسی عدد به حروف تندیل بشه؟

دیدگاه شما

(ضروری)
(ضروری,نمایش داده نمی شود)
(ضروری)

خبرنامه آفیس